php按钮怎么写网页跳转

worktile 其他 116

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    以上是PHP代码实现网页跳转的方式。

    其中,target_page.php是跳转目标页面的文件名。该文件可以是相对路径或绝对路径。

    通过header函数,设置Location响应头,将用户重定向到目标页面。然后,使用exit函数终止当前文件的执行。

    请注意,该代码需要在任何输出之前执行,以避免出现“headers already sent”的错误。

    如果需要在特定条件下进行跳转,可以根据相关逻辑来编写PHP代码,并在合适的地方调用上述代码实现跳转。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网页跳转是网页开发中非常常见的操作,通过点击按钮或链接来实现不同页面之间的切换。在PHP中,网页跳转可以通过header()函数来实现,具体的语法如下:

    header(“Location: 目标页面的URL”);

    下面是详细解释:

    1. 在PHP中,使用header()函数可以向浏览器发送一个HTTP头部信息。通过在header()函数中设置Location参数,并指定目标页面的URL,就可以实现网页跳转。

    2. 跳转的目标页面可以是当前网站内的其它页面,也可以是外部网站的页面。只需要将目标页面的URL作为Location参数的值即可。

    3. 注意,在调用header()函数之前不能有任何输出,包括HTML标签、空格以及换行符等。否则会导致header()函数无法正常执行,从而导致跳转失败。

    4. 为了确保跳转的顺利进行,通常会在调用header()函数之后立即使用exit()函数来终止当前脚本的执行。这样可以避免脚本继续执行而干扰跳转的过程。

    5. 在实际应用中,通常会结合条件判断来确定是否需要进行跳转。例如,用户登录成功后需要跳转到个人信息页面,可以在登录验证成功之后使用header()函数来进行跳转。

    需要注意的是,网页跳转并不是唯一的方式来实现页面切换。还可以通过标签的href属性来实现页面的跳转,或者使用JavaScript的window.location.href属性来实现动态跳转。具体选择哪种方式取决于实际需求和开发习惯。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在网页开发中,实现页面跳转是常见且必不可少的操作。PHP是一种常用的服务器端脚本语言,可以通过编写PHP代码来实现网页的跳转功能。下面我将从两种常见的跳转方式:重定向和超链接,来详细讲解PHP如何实现网页跳转。

    一、重定向跳转

    重定向是指在服务器端通过发送特定的HTTP响应头来告诉浏览器进行跳转。PHP中可以使用header()函数来设置HTTP头。重定向跳转的步骤如下:

    1.确定目标页面的URL。例如,假设目标页面为”target.php”。

    2.在需要进行跳转的php文件中,使用header()函数设置HTTP头。将响应状态码设置为302,表示临时重定向。并将”Location”响应头设置为目标页面的URL,告诉浏览器进行跳转。代码如下:

    “`php
    header(“HTTP/1.1 302 Moved Temporarily”);
    header(“Location: target.php”);
    “`

    3.完成以上步骤后,通过访问设置了重定向的PHP文件即可实现网页跳转。

    二、超链接跳转

    超链接是指在网页中添加一个链接,用户点击链接后会跳转到指定的页面。在PHP中,可以通过在HTML代码中使用标签来创建超链接。

    1.确定目标页面的URL。

    2.在需要添加超链接的PHP文件中,将标签放入HTML代码中,并设置超链接的href属性为目标页面的URL。例如,代码如下:

    “`php
    点击跳转
    “`

    3.通过访问包含超链接的PHP文件,用户点击链接后即可进行网页跳转。

    通过以上方法,我们可以根据实际需求选择合适的方式来实现网页跳转。重定向可以在服务器端进行跳转,适用于需要在脚本中进行判断后再跳转的情况。而超链接是在HTML代码中创建链接,适用于静态页面的跳转。

    总结:

    PHP中实现网页跳转有两种常见方式:重定向和超链接。重定向使用header()函数设置HTTP头,通知浏览器进行跳转;超链接通过在HTML中添加标签,设置超链接的目标页面URL来实现跳转。根据实际需求选择合适的方式,可以实现页面跳转的功能。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部